Dalam dunia pengembangan perangkat lunak yang serba cepat, meluncurkan fitur baru atau pembaruan tanpa mengganggu pengalaman pengguna adalah sebuah seni. Di sinilah strategi canary deployment berperan penting. Metode ini memungkinkan tim untuk memperkenalkan perubahan pada sebagian kecil pengguna terlebih dahulu, memantau dampaknya, dan hanya melanjutkan peluncuran penuh jika semuanya berjalan lancar. Ini adalah jaring pengaman yang krusial untuk menjaga reputasi dan stabilitas aplikasi Anda.
Namun, efektivitas canary deployment sangat bergantung pada infrastruktur yang mendukungnya. Pemilihan lokasi server bukan sekadar preferensi geografis, melainkan keputusan strategis yang dapat memengaruhi latensi, keandalan, dan bahkan persepsi pasar. Artikel ini akan membahas secara mendalam mengapa memanfaatkan server di Jepang bisa menjadi pilihan yang sangat cerdas untuk strategi canary deployment Anda, menawarkan keunggulan yang tidak hanya teknis tetapi juga bersifat strategis.
Memahami Esensi Canary Deployment
Canary deployment adalah teknik peluncuran perangkat lunak yang meminimalkan risiko dengan secara bertahap memperkenalkan versi baru aplikasi kepada sebagian kecil pengguna. Bayangkan Anda memiliki burung kenari (canary) di tambang batu bara; jika burung itu menunjukkan tanda-tanda distress, artinya ada bahaya. Mirip, jika versi “canary” dari perangkat lunak Anda menunjukkan masalah, Anda dapat menghentikan peluncuran sebelum memengaruhi semua pengguna.
Proses ini biasanya melibatkan pengalihan lalu lintas pengguna secara bertahap, misalnya 1% ke versi baru, kemudian 5%, dan seterusnya. Selama periode ini, tim memantau metrik kinerja, log kesalahan, dan umpan balik pengguna secara intensif. Jika ada masalah yang terdeteksi, perubahan dapat dengan cepat di-rollback tanpa menyebabkan dampak luas, menjaga stabilitas layanan utama.
Mengapa Memilih Lokasi Server Jepang untuk Canary Anda?
Pemilihan lokasi server yang tepat adalah kunci dalam setiap strategi deployment, dan untuk canary deployment, lokasi strategis menjadi lebih kritikal. Jepang menawarkan kombinasi unik dari infrastruktur teknologi canggih, stabilitas ekonomi, dan lokasi geografis yang strategis di kawasan Asia-Pasifik. Faktor-faktor ini menjadikannya kandidat utama untuk menjalankan percobaan canary Anda.
Tidak hanya itu, Jepang dikenal dengan budaya ketelitian dan kualitas, yang juga tercermin dalam standar pusat data dan layanan infrastruktur mereka. Dengan memilih server di Jepang, Anda tidak hanya mendapatkan keuntungan teknis, tetapi juga secara tidak langsung memanfaatkan reputasi keandalan yang melekat pada negara tersebut, sebuah aset tak ternilai untuk setiap operasi bisnis yang serius.
Keunggulan Infrastruktur Digital Jepang
Jepang adalah salah satu pemimpin global dalam inovasi teknologi dan memiliki infrastruktur digital yang sangat maju. Pusat data di Jepang dibangun dengan standar tertinggi, menampilkan redundansi yang kuat, sistem pendingin canggih, dan konektivitas serat optik berkecepatan tinggi yang menjamin kinerja optimal dan waktu aktif maksimal. Ini adalah lingkungan yang ideal untuk menguji fitur-fitur penting dalam skala kecil sebelum peluncuran besar. Jelajahi lebih lanjut di server jepang terbaik!
Jaringan telekomunikasi mereka juga merupakan salah satu yang paling canggih di dunia, menawarkan latensi sangat rendah ke tujuan utama di Asia, Amerika Utara, dan bahkan Eropa. Keunggulan infrastruktur ini berarti data Anda akan bergerak lebih cepat, pengujian canary Anda akan lebih responsif, dan Anda dapat mengumpulkan metrik kinerja yang lebih akurat dari pengguna percobaan Anda.
Manfaat Latensi Rendah untuk Validasi Canary
Latensi adalah salah satu faktor terpenting dalam pengalaman pengguna. Dalam konteks canary deployment, latensi rendah berarti pengguna yang dialihkan ke versi baru aplikasi Anda akan mengalami kinerja yang sama atau lebih baik, memberikan gambaran yang lebih akurat tentang potensi keberhasilan peluncuran. Jika server canary Anda memiliki latensi tinggi, hasil pengujian bisa bias dan tidak mencerminkan kinerja sebenarnya.
Server Jepang yang berlokasi strategis meminimalkan perjalanan data ke pengguna di Asia Pasifik dan sekitarnya, mengurangi latensi secara signifikan. Ini memungkinkan Anda untuk mendapatkan umpan balik real-time yang cepat dan akurat tentang kinerja aplikasi, penggunaan sumber daya, dan potensi bug, yang sangat penting untuk mengambil keputusan yang tepat mengenai kelanjutan atau penghentian deployment.
Ketersediaan dan Redundansi Server Tingkat Tinggi
Ketersediaan adalah prioritas utama untuk setiap infrastruktur digital, terlebih lagi saat Anda menguji fitur-fitur penting. Pusat data di Jepang dirancang dengan mempertimbangkan ketahanan terhadap bencana alam, seperti gempa bumi, dengan standar rekayasa yang sangat tinggi. Mereka menawarkan redundansi ganda untuk semua komponen kritikal—mulai dari pasokan listrik, jaringan, hingga sistem pendingin—memastikan operasional yang tidak terputus.
Tingkat ketersediaan dan redundansi ini sangat vital untuk canary deployment. Ini menjamin bahwa lingkungan pengujian Anda selalu aktif dan stabil, memungkinkan Anda mengumpulkan data yang konsisten dan andal. Anda tidak perlu khawatir tentang gangguan tak terduga yang dapat memutarbalikkan hasil pengujian atau, lebih buruk lagi, memengaruhi sejumlah kecil pengguna yang berpartisipasi dalam fase canary.
Akses Pasar Asia yang Strategis dan Luas
Jika pasar target utama aplikasi Anda adalah Asia, menempatkan server canary di Jepang adalah langkah yang sangat cerdas. Ini memungkinkan Anda untuk menguji fitur baru dengan audiens yang relevan secara geografis, budaya, dan demografis. Dengan mengumpulkan data kinerja dan umpan balik dari pengguna di wilayah ini, Anda mendapatkan wawasan yang lebih akurat tentang bagaimana fitur baru akan diterima oleh pasar yang sebenarnya.
Keunggulan ini sangat berarti bagi perusahaan yang berfokus pada ekspansi di Asia, termasuk negara-negara seperti Korea Selatan, Cina, dan negara-negara Asia Tenggara. Pengujian dengan server Jepang tidak hanya mengurangi latensi bagi pengguna di wilayah tersebut, tetapi juga membantu Anda memahami pola penggunaan dan preferensi lokal, yang pada gilirannya dapat menginformasikan pengembangan produk di masa mendatang.
Standar Keamanan Data dan Kepatuhan Regulasi
Keamanan data adalah kekhawatiran utama bagi setiap bisnis. Jepang memiliki kerangka hukum yang kuat terkait privasi dan keamanan data, termasuk undang-undang perlindungan data pribadi yang komprehensif. Pusat data di Jepang juga mematuhi standar keamanan fisik dan siber internasional tertinggi, memberikan lapisan perlindungan ekstra untuk data Anda selama fase canary.
Dengan menempatkan data canary Anda di server yang mematuhi regulasi ketat, Anda tidak hanya melindungi informasi sensitif tetapi juga membangun kepercayaan dengan pengguna Anda. Ini sangat penting saat Anda memperkenalkan fitur baru yang mungkin melibatkan penanganan data pengguna atau interaksi baru, memastikan bahwa percobaan Anda dilakukan dalam lingkungan yang aman dan sesuai.
Integrasi Mulus dengan Alur CI/CD Modern
Server Jepang, terutama yang ditawarkan oleh penyedia layanan cloud besar, sangat mudah diintegrasikan ke dalam alur Continuous Integration/Continuous Delivery (CI/CD) Anda. Dengan API yang kuat dan alat otomatisasi, Anda dapat dengan mudah mengotomatiskan provisioning, konfigurasi, dan manajemen lingkungan canary. Hal ini memungkinkan tim Anda untuk fokus pada pengembangan dan pengujian, bukan pada manajemen infrastruktur yang rumit.
Kemampuan untuk mengotomatiskan seluruh siklus hidup canary deployment, mulai dari peluncuran hingga pemantauan dan rollback, adalah game-changer. Ini tidak hanya meningkatkan efisiensi tetapi juga mengurangi potensi kesalahan manusia, memastikan bahwa setiap deployment canary dijalankan dengan presisi dan konsistensi, memanfaatkan penuh kapasitas server di Jepang.
Pentingnya Monitoring Real-time dalam Canary Deployment
Monitoring real-time adalah tulang punggung dari setiap canary deployment yang sukses. Tanpa kemampuan untuk melihat metrik kinerja, log kesalahan, dan umpan balik pengguna secara instan, tujuan utama canary deployment—yaitu meminimalkan risiko—tidak akan tercapai. Server yang berkinerja tinggi dan latensi rendah di Jepang mendukung sistem monitoring untuk bekerja secara optimal, mengirimkan data tanpa penundaan.
Integrasi dengan alat monitoring canggih menjadi lebih efektif ketika infrastruktur pendukungnya kuat. Dengan server Jepang, data dari canary Anda dapat dengan cepat diproses dan divisualisasikan, memungkinkan tim Anda untuk bereaksi secara proaktif terhadap masalah apa pun yang muncul. Ini memastikan bahwa setiap anomali terdeteksi dini, sebelum berpotensi merugikan sebagian besar basis pengguna Anda.
Strategi Rollback Cepat dan Efisien
Salah satu manfaat terbesar dari canary deployment adalah kemampuan untuk melakukan rollback cepat jika ada masalah. Namun, kecepatan rollback ini sangat tergantung pada infrastruktur dan otomatisasi yang mendasarinya. Server di Jepang, dengan keandalannya dan integrasinya dengan platform cloud modern, memfasilitasi rollback yang mulus dan efisien. Baca selengkapnya di server thailand terbaik!
Dalam skenario terburuk, ketika canary menunjukkan kinerja yang buruk atau bug kritis, Anda perlu dapat mengalihkan lalu lintas kembali ke versi lama dalam hitungan menit, bahkan detik. Infrastruktur yang solid di Jepang memastikan bahwa proses rollback ini dilakukan dengan dampak minimal pada pengguna dan layanan, menjaga integritas aplikasi Anda.
Kesimpulan
Memanfaatkan server di Jepang untuk strategi canary deployment Anda bukan sekadar pilihan teknis, melainkan langkah strategis yang cerdas. Dengan menggabungkan keunggulan infrastruktur digital Jepang yang canggih, latensi rendah, ketersediaan tinggi, akses pasar strategis, keamanan data yang kuat, dan kemampuan integrasi yang mulus, Anda menciptakan lingkungan pengujian yang optimal untuk fitur-fitur baru Anda.
Keputusan ini akan memperkuat jaring pengaman Anda dalam peluncuran perangkat lunak, memungkinkan Anda untuk berinovasi dengan percaya diri sambil meminimalkan risiko. Bagi perusahaan yang menargetkan pasar global, khususnya di Asia, server Jepang untuk canary deployment menawarkan keuntungan kompetitif yang signifikan, memastikan bahwa peluncuran Anda tidak hanya aman tetapi juga memberikan pengalaman terbaik bagi pengguna di seluruh dunia.
Blog Server Luar Internasional Teknologi & Infrastruktur Global